    Klipse

    Klipse

    Klipse is a JavaScript plugin for embedding interactive code snippets

    Klipse is a JavaScript plugin for embedding interactive code snippets in tech blogs. Technically, Klipse is a small piece of JavaScript code that evaluates code snippets in the browser and it is pluggable on any web page. The klipse plugin is a JavaScript tag that transforms static code snippets of an HTML page into live and interactive snippets. If you want to integrate Klipse inside a Clojurescript project, it is recommended to consume Klipse as a Clojurescript library like any other Clojurescript lib. The Klipse plugin can be easily styled with CSS, which can be applied both to the Klipse plugin's own elements, and to the CodeMirror editor's elements. Much of the styling you'll apply will be to CodeMirror, as it contains all the CSS classes to style the code itself. Surrounding CodeMirror is the Klipse plugin, the styles of which control the plugin's borders, and the executed code's output.

    LGML

    LGPL GML parser

    LGML is a GML parser under the LGPL license. The aim is to parse a GML document or fragment in order to get a WKT output. 2D and 3D inputs are both handled, but it is not permitted to have mixed geometries. The caller can choose if the input coordinates are parsed as X, Y, Z (if present) order, or Y, X, Z (if present) order. The willing of the project is to be a starting point useful for developers that need to parse GML objects in order to use them, for example, in the context of OGC catalogue projects. The library is compiled using Java 1.5 or 1.6. For now, supported inputs are: LineString, MultiLineString, MultiPoint, MultiPolygon, Point, Polygon, MultiSurface (in an experimental way: the only child object handled is Polygon).     LWKT

    LGPL WKT parser

    LWKT is a WKT parser under the LGPL license. It have not dependencies: it is pure Java compiled with 1.5 or 1.6 version. The output can be as GML 2 or 3 version, optionally setting a SRS name. Supported inputs are: POINT, MULTIPOINT, LINESTRING, MULTILINESTRING, POLYGON, MULTIPOLYGON For each of them, are handled both 2D inputs like: POINT(2.4 12.66) and 3D inputs like: POINT Z(2.4 12.66 0.0) At the following URL: http://95.110.227.201:8080/lwkt is exposed a minimal web interface in order to test it. To do: -add the possibility to parse the input as XY(Z) or YX(Z)

    LaTeX.CSS

    LaTeX.CSS

    LaTeX.css is a library that makes your website look like a LaTeX doc

    This almost class-less CSS library turns your HTML document into a website that looks like a LATEX document. Write semantic HTML, and you are good to go. The source code can be found on GitHub. LaTeX.css is a minimal, almost class-less CSS library that makes any website look like a LaTeX document. Add any optional classes to elements with special styles (author subtitle, abstract, lemmas, theorems, etc.). The labels of theorems, definitions, lemmas and proofs can be changed to other supported languages by including the snippet provided in addition to the main CSS file. Sidenotes can be used as an alternative to footnotes, where the user does not have to jump to the bottom of the page to read it. On mobile, click the superscript to reveal the note. Add a class of left to the span with the sidenote class to make the note appear on the left side of the page on instead of right.

    Language Server Protocol for Emacs

    Language Server Protocol for Emacs

    Emacs client/library for the language server protocol

    Client for Language Server Protocol (v3.14). lsp-mode aims to provide IDE-like experience by providing optional integration with the most popular Emacs packages like company, flycheck and projectile. Works out of the box and automatically upgrades if additional packages are present. Choose between full-blown IDE with flashy UI or minimal distraction-free. Supports all features in Language Server Protocol v3.14. Semantic tokens as defined by LSP 3.16 (compatible language servers include recent development builds of clangd and rust-analyzer). If LSP server supports completion, lsp-mode use symbols returned by the server to present the user when completion is triggered via completion-at-point. For UI feedback of the available code actions, you can enable lsp-modeline-code-actions-mode which shows available code actions on modeline.

    Layout Parser

    Map fixed-length files to java objects allowing read from and write to

    Parses and formats positional and CSV data into and from Java Objects based on a layout defined in xml format. Particularly useful for developers that need to integrate Java with legacy systems/languages that only understand positional data (i.e.: Cobol).

    LinuxFont

    Create and investigate PSF2 fonts

    This utility is created with the aim of accelerating development of Linux PSF2 (framebuffer) fonts. It does not work with X fonts. The program can "explode" existing PSF2 fonts, creating an human-readable graphical representation of each glyph which can then be re-compiled into a PSF2 font. The project supports the use of unicode tables at the end of fonts, but currently (Dec, 2012) not fully (sequences are not supported), but this should be simple to amend.

    List.js

    List.js

    Library for adding search, sort, filters and flexibility to tables

    Tiny, invisible and simple, yet powerful and incredibly fast vanilla JavaScript that adds search, sort, filters and flexibility to plain HTML lists, tables, or anything. List.js can be used in three different ways. It can be on existing HTML, it can create it's own HTML or a combination of both methods. Works both lists, tables and almost anything else. E.g. <div>,<ul>,<table>, etc. Simple templating system that adds possibility to add, edit, remove items. Perfect library for adding search, sort, filters and flexibility to tables, lists and various HTML elements. Built to be invisible and work on existing HTML. Simple and invisible. Easy to apply to existing HTML. No dependencies. Fast, and tiny (5KB minified&gzip). It can handle thousands of items. It is easy to add search input and sort buttons with just a few classes and attributes in your HTML. ‘Automagical’ because List.js registers the event handlers, searches/sorts and updates the list for you.
